  4. I asked my DD what she would suggest for your daughter’s reading, since DD read ahead of her age. She loved:

    The Witch Family, by Eleanor Estes.
    Betsy-Tacy, by Maud Hart Lovelace, and all the rest of the series.
    The Lion, The Witch and the Wardrobe, by C.S.Lewis.
    The Saturdays, by Elizabeth Enright.
    The American Girl stories.

    The older Lois Lenski books, such as Strawberry Girl, Blue Ridge Billy and Bayou Suzette, might catch your daughter’s fancy, as might the Andrew Lang Books, i.e. Blue Fairy Book etc.
